Summary

Conducts procedures and tests using MRI equipment to acquire and analyze patient diagnostic data.

Hours: Daytime hours, 4 days per week

Responsibilities
  • 1. Patient Identification- Uses professional manners and methods, verifies patient identification, obtains patient history, assists patients and family members that require extra attention, insures patient understanding whenever possible, and insures patient safety. Verifies patient identification, asks and documents pregnancy status on patients of child bearing age.
  • 2. MRI Technology- Demonstrates knowledge of MRI and cross-sectional human anatomy. Is competent in the operation of the MRI scanners, proficient in automatic injections of MRI contrast, disc drives, gateways, PACS and laser printers. Maintains active status with ARRT or ARMRIT by accruing CE's when needed. Interprets protocols and selects appropriate scanning parameters, shares knowledge with fellow MRI technologists and uses technical knowledge to assist in actively trouble shooting problems with respect to equipment and protocols
  • 3. Contrast- Administers oral contrast to adult and pediatric patients according to protocols, establishes intravenous lines, administers IV contrast following safe and proper injection procedures, follows correct procedure to determine contrast eligibility, checks appropriate lab values before contrast injection per protocol.
  • 4. Image Transfer- Maintains thorough understanding of PACS, and transmits images to QC, UNCH's EMR, EPIC and PACS, verifies and segments images at the QC station, accesses IMPAX service tools to verify images transmission, completes, modifies and/or cancels orders in an appropriate and timely manner, cancels duplicate orders to avoid duplicate billing. Insures that all charge information is accurate. Verifies patient identification in accordance with UNC policy, insures that all appropriate demographic information is accurate and on the PACS images.
  • 5. Other Duties- Performs task in a timely manner, runs the schedule creating a consistent workflow, volunteers to work on challenging tasks, difficult procedures and new research, produces quality diagnostic images, reviews patient's chart and reports for correlation, maintains a clean and orderly work environment, creates and keeps documentation of incidents as improvement opportunities for employees and the department. Precept new employees and students

Education Requirements
  • * Completion of an accredited educational program in Radiological Science or completion within 3 months at time of application.
Licensure/Certification Requirements
  • * Must be registered with the American Registry of Radiological Sciences, American Registry of Magnetic Resonance Imaging Technologists or registry eligible. For registry eligible candidates: must provide a copy of diploma from accredited program.
  • * Requires advanced certification in MR within one year of employment.
  • * Successful candidates must become registered within one year of employment and must maintain their registry status and continuing education requirements annually.
  • * All imaging specialists are required to maintain current competency in HCP BLS.
